你可以在"platform"字段下找到镜像的架构信息,如amd64(x86_64)、arm、arm64等。 2. 使用docker inspect命令查看已下载镜像 如果你已经拉取了镜像,可以使用docker inspect来查看镜像的详细信息,包括它的架构。 代码语言:bash 复制 dockerinspect<镜像ID或镜像名称> 输出中查找"Architecture"字段,它会显示镜像的架构。
2. 使用 docker inspect 查看架构 在得知镜像名称与 TAG 之后,可以使用docker inspect命令来获取详细信息,包括架构。 dockerinspect nginx:latest 1. 输出示例 这个命令会输出一个 JSON 格式的详细信息,包括镜像的大小、创建时间以及架构等数据。下面是可能的输出片段: [{"Id":"sha256:4bb46517e2ee...","RepoTag...
要查看当前镜像的平台架构,可以使用Docker命令docker inspect来查看。下面是一个示例,假设我们有一个名为myimage的镜像: dockerinspect myimage|jq'.[0].Architecture' 1. 上面的命令中,我们使用docker inspect命令查看myimage镜像的详细信息,并通过jq工具提取其中的Architecture字段,即平台架构信息。 示例 假设我们有一...
首先,我们需要获取该镜像的ID,然后使用docker inspect命令来查看该镜像的架构信息。 下面是具体的步骤和代码示例: 获取Docker镜像的ID: dockerimages 1. 通过上述命令,找到名为ubuntu的镜像ID。 使用docker inspect命令查看镜像的架构信息: dockerinspect<image_id>|grepArchitecture 1. 将上述命令中的<image_id>替换为...
Docker查看镜像支持的架构 在使用Docker构建应用程序时,我们通常会使用不同的镜像来支持不同的架构。而有时候我们需要查看某个镜像支持的架构信息,以便确认是否适用于我们的目标平台。 什么是镜像支持的架构 Docker镜像可以构建为支持不同的CPU架构,比如x86、ARM等。当我们构建一个镜像时,可以选择指定支持的架构,也可以...
dockerimages // 列出本地所有镜像 1. 查看容器列表: dockerps-a// 列出所有容器,包括已停止的容器 1. 查看容器的详细信息: dockerinspect my-docker-container // 查看名为'my-docker-container'的容器的详细信息 1. 以上是几个常用的Docker命令,通过执行这些命令,你可以查看Docker镜像平台架构的相关信息。
最后,我们需要查看选择的镜像的架构信息。在Docker中,每个镜像都由多个层组成,每个层代表容器文件系统的一个部分。可以使用以下命令来查看镜像的层级结构: dockerhistory<镜像名称> 1. 上述命令将返回一个包含镜像各个层级的列表,每个层级由其ID、创建时间、命令和大小等信息组成。
首先,使用以下命令拉取nginx镜像: dockerpull nginx 1. 然后,使用docker inspect命令查看镜像的详细信息: dockerinspect nginx 1. 在输出中,我们可以找到Architecture字段,它显示了镜像的架构信息。例如,如果我们看到"Architecture": "amd64",则表示该镜像基于x86架构构建。
接下来,我们可以使用以下命令来构建镜像: $dockerbuild-tmyapp:latest ./app 1. 上述命令使用docker build来构建名为myapp:latest的镜像,构建上下文为当前目录下的app目录。 构建完成后,我们可以使用以下命令来查看镜像的架构: $dockerinspect myapp:latest--format='{{json .}}'|jq'.[0].Architecture'"amd64"...
打开终端并运行以下命令,以查看Docker镜像的详细信息: dockerinspect<镜像名> 1. 在命令中,将<镜像名>替换为您要查看的Docker镜像的名称或ID。执行此命令后,将显示关于该镜像的详细信息,包括架构信息。 查找"Architecture"字段,以确定Docker镜像的架构类型。通常,架构类型可以是"amd64"、"arm64"等,取决于所用操作...